If service is good in your area, and has been good (which of course is in no terms a prediction of what's to come ), you might consider signing up for an annual plan if your budget affords it, and the annual rate they're offering you is based on your older, lower rate.
I did this back in mid december (service out here in 60115 has been pretty good since mid october after they did some upgrades to the area) Since dsl is no an option, the attbi/comcrap monopoly wins my business 
I locked in a rate of 42.95 for the year (actually 11 months since the 12th is free). Now, its unlikely they'll change prices on me while on the annual plan.
In addition, the referral credits come in handy too. I'm not sure what their limit is, but I've got 2 in so far, so that helps reduce the rate some as well.
If none of these options work for you, consider adding basic cable for $10 a month (if you're on a 39.99/42.xx rate, this would be less than paying $60/month).
